On Mon, 2010-12-27 at 23:21 -0500, Christopher Faylor wrote: > On Mon, Dec 27, 2010 at 09:42:24PM -0600, Yaakov (Cygwin/X) wrote: > >Recently I have been unable to link very large libraries, in particular > >libgcj (from gcc-4.5.x) and libQtWebKit (from qt4): > > > >collect2: ld terminated with signal 1 [Hangup] > > 2 [main] ld 5544 C:\cygwin17\usr\i686-pc-cygwin\bin\ld.exe: *** > >fatal error - cmalloc would have returned NULL > > > >This occurs with recent snapshots, > > "recent snapshots" means that it doesn't happen with older snapshots and > with 1.7.7? Not quite; I meant "recent snapshots" indicating that the problem currently exists in CVS, which is what I've been running recently. I did go back to 1.7.7 and it is affected as well, but not 1.7.6. None the snapshots between these two releases (IOW from 20100818 to 20100829) are affected either, so it must have been one of the changes in the 20100901 snapshot *before* the 1.7.7 release.
